Transponder keys
The transponder chip that is inside your Audi key acts as a security device. It transmits a signal that is unique to the key as well as the car and allows it to start only when the appropriate key is used. The car's computer will recognize the key and then start the engine. This technology is designed to prevent thieves from stealing your car and to prevent people from using your keys to start the engine of another vehicle.
The new Audi key will feature the appearance of a cap made of plastic and a transponder built in. This is a great feature as it stops your keys from being duplicated. However, your key may still be able to be cut and used by criminals. It's because the system may be tricked in certain ways, and therefore it's not 100% secure.
Car thieves have been a big problem since cars became popular, and the transponder chip is an excellent way to keep your car secure. The chips transmit an electromagnetic signal that only the vehicle is able to receive. This is why it's important to only use your own keys to start the vehicle.
The chips are embedded in the key fob and don't require batteries as they operate on radio frequencies. They are also more difficult to steal because they have to be within a specific distance of the vehicle to detect the signal. This technology has reduced the number of auto thefts, but it's not completely secure.

Key duplication
Key duplication allows you to have multiple copies of one key. This is crucial for your safety and security, whether you need a spare key for your car or to ensure that your home and office keys do not fall into the wrong hand. But, there are some things you should know before getting a duplicate of your key.
Keys can be duplicated using either a pattern grinding machine, or punching machine. The key is measured with a gauge for the depth of the notch. It is then placed in a machine which has a slider which adjusts to match the depth. The key is then cut by the lever that is pressed. This process requires a large amount of skill to execute correctly. An error could lead to an uneven pressure, a misplaced position or even a mistake in the indexing holes. This is why you should be able to trust a locksmith that has experience with this type of work.
Certain keys come with some keys have a "Do not duplicate" stamp to warn people against making copies. It isn't illegal to duplicate keys in most places.
